Summary: Deep Intermediate Blues (and Rock) Instruction
Comment: Peter Gelling continues on from "Blues Lead Guitar Method". He gives you the basic blues scales with the blue notes added. He teaches a song with each scale (which helps to commit the scale to memory). He also covers arpeggios, and various rhythms. The book introduces a few new techniques along with some really good signiture licks from blues masters. The book takes a little work, but it is fun an will improve your style.

Summary: Superb starting point
Comment: If you have some knowledge of the guitar, you can play the chords, you're learning your scales, but you don't know where to get started with playing lead--this book is probably the best place to start I know of. You start out learning some very simple little licks, and then after you've learned a few, you find them strung together into a 12-bar blues--and suddenly, miraculously, for maybe 20 seconds, you find that you can actually play lead guitar! How cool is that? (All examples are played fast, then slow, like REALLY slow.)
As the book progresses, the leads get more complex, and therefore more difficult to learn. But there is nothing here that is of the advanced caliber. I don't mean that as a criticism--this stuff SHOULD be aimed at the beginner to intermediate. But the stuff isn't all wimpy, straight pentatonic stuff either. It isn't boring. You will learn some really cool-sounding music from the book, played all over the fretboard. And there is PLENTY to learn.
At the same time, the book won't take you very far beyond the introductory lead playing stage. So don't expect this book to make you the next BB King. And the coverage of theory is minimal at best, as it is in all such books that promise to teach you everything there is to know about lead guitar.
About the biggest complaint I can come up with is that I found the guy's English (or Australian?) accent (a rural accent, I believe?) vaguely annoying after a while. But if that's the most you can complain about, you know you've gotten a good value. In fact, this book would be worth at least twice what they're charging for it.
As a final note, raw beginners could probably make use of this book, but it would be very slow going. Advanced players would be bored by it. It is targeted directly at players who have taken the time to learn pentatonic scales fairly well, understand basic chord progressions, but don't have a clue how to make interesting solos.
